The invention discloses a photovoltaic power generation maximum power tracking method capable of correcting open-circuit voltage online in order to solve the problem that when outside environment temperature greatly changes, a photovoltaic array cannot quickly track the maximum power point. The method is characterized by including the steps of building a model of a given temperature and an irradiance photovoltaic cell, building a model of different temperatures and the irradiance photovoltaic cell, improving the maximum power tracking control strategy of the open-circuit voltage, a grid-connected inverter control strategy and other contents, and building a photovoltaic power generation system including a photovoltaic cell model, a boost chopper circuit and a grid-connected inverter through PSCAD/EMTDC simulation software; the open-circuit voltage is updated according to outside environment changes, so that the photovoltaic system is stabilized at the maximum power point quickly; the incremental conductance method is introduced to improve the steady-state performance at the maximum power point so as to further improve energy conversion efficiency of the photovoltaic power generation system; an effective means is provided for improving the maximum power point tracking efficiency of the photovoltaic array and reducing energy loss of the photovoltaic array.

technical field [0001] The invention relates to the technical field of photovoltaic power generation, and relates to a maximum power tracking method of photovoltaic power generation for online correction of open circuit voltage. Background technique [0002] my country is rich in solar energy resources, and vigorously developing solar power generation is an effective way to increase my country's energy supply, adjust energy structure, achieve sustainable energy development and protect the environment. However, due to the relatively high cost of photovoltaic cells and the low conversion efficiency, the output power changes with changes in light intensity, ambient temperature and load. The efficiency of power generation system to reduce power loss has important research significance. [0003] In the traditional open-circuit voltage method, updating the open-circuit voltage will interrupt the normal operation of the system, which will interfere with the operation of the system...
